Dry pet food may be more environmentally friendly than wet food

[ad_1]

Pet owners may have a new reason to reach for the food.

Veterinary nutritionist Vivian Pedrinelli of the University of São Paulo in Brazil and colleagues report that dry cat and dog food tends to be better for the environment than wet food. Their analysis of more than 900 hundred pet diets showed that nearly 90 percent of the calories in wet food come from animal sources. This is almost twice the calorie content of animal ingredients in dry food.

The team factored in the cost of different pet food ingredients across several environmental measures. The results, described on November 17 Scientific reportsI suggest Wet food production uses more land and water They emit more greenhouse gases than dry foods.

Scientists already know that Human diets rich in meat cause greenhouse gas emissions (SN: 5/5/22). But when it comes to environmental sustainability, “we shouldn’t ignore pet food,” says Peter Alexander, an economist at the University of Edinburgh who was not involved in the work.

Alexander says the extent to which different pet foods affect the environment isn’t clear. Commercial cat and dog fares are not usually made with premium cuts of meat. Instead, ingredient lists often include animal by-products — which people aren’t likely to eat anyway.

How to calculate the carbon cost of these residues is an ongoing debate, says Gregory Okin, an ecologist at the University of California, Los Angeles, who was not involved in the study.

Some argue that by-products in pet food are essentially free, as they come from animals that have already been bred for human consumption. Others note that any calorie requires energy and therefore has an environmental cost. Additionally, the animal ingredients in pet food may not be just scraps. If they contain even a small amount of edible meat, this can make a huge impact.

Okin says knowing there is an environmental difference between a moist morsel and a crunchy treat can be beneficial to environmentally conscious pet owners. Having this information on hand at the grocery store, he adds, is “very important when people are making decisions.” “There are consumers who want attention.”
